Why Sign Permitting Is More Than Paperwork
Every city, township, and county has its own sign ordinances—and many contradict one another. Size limits, height restrictions, illumination rules, setbacks, zoning overlays, historic districts, and landlord requirements all intersect.
Permitting problems usually come from:
Incomplete or inaccurate drawings
Misinterpretation of local sign codes
Missing electrical or structural details
Submissions made without site verification
Late discovery of zoning or landlord constraints

When Do You Need Professional Permitting Support?
You should involve permitting early when:
Installing new exterior or illuminated signage
Modifying existing sign size, height, or location
Entering a new city or state
Working within historic or overlay districts
Launching a multi-location rollout
